EQT Corp

Wall Street analysts forecast EQ6 stock price to rise over the next 12 months.

According to Wall Street analysts, the average 1-year price target for EQ6 is 63.081 EUR with a low forecast of 50.759 EUR and a high forecast of 73.136 EUR.
